generate ObjectID

define (require, exports, module) -> | |
'use strict' | |
BinaryParser = require('lib/binary-parser') | |
hexTable = ((if i <= 15 then '0' else '') + i.toString(16) for i in [0...256]) | |
class ObjectID | |
constructor: (id, _hex) -> | |
@_bsontype = 'ObjectID' | |
@MACHINE_ID = parseInt(Math.random() * 0xFFFFFF, 10) | |
if id? and id.length isnt 12 and id.length isnt 24 | |
throw new Error("Argument passed in must be a single String of 12 bytes or a string of 24 hex characters") | |
if not id? | |
@id = @generate() | |
else if id? and id.length is 12 | |
@id = id | |
else if /^[0-9a-fA-F]{24}$/.test(id) | |
return @createFromHexString(id) | |
else | |
throw new Error("Value passed in is not a valid 24 character hex string") | |
generate: -> | |
unixTime = parseInt(Date.now() / 1000, 10) | |
time4Bytes = BinaryParser.encodeInt(unixTime, 32, true, true) | |
machine3Bytes = BinaryParser.encodeInt(@MACHINE_ID, 24, false) | |
pid2Bytes = BinaryParser.fromShort(if typeof process is 'undefined' then Math.floor(Math.random() * 100000) else process.pid) | |
index3Bytes = BinaryParser.encodeInt(@get_inc(), 24, false, true) | |
time4Bytes + machine3Bytes + pid2Bytes + index3Bytes | |
toHexString: -> | |
hexString = '' | |
for i in [0...@id.length] | |
hexString += hexTable[@id.charCodeAt(i)] | |
hexString | |
toString: -> @toHexString() | |
inspect: -> @toHexString() | |
getTime: -> Math.floor(BinaryParser.decodeInt(@id.substring(0, 4), 32, true, true)) * 1000 | |
getTimestamp: -> | |
timestamp = new Date() | |
timestamp.setTime(@getTime()) | |
timestamp | |
get_inc: -> ObjectID.index = (ObjectID.index + 1) % 0xFFFFFF | |
createFromHexString: (hexString) -> | |
result = '' | |
for i in [0...24] when i % 2 is 0 | |
result += BinaryParser.fromByte(parseInt(hexString.substr(i, 2), 16)) | |
new ObjectID(result, hexString) | |
ObjectID.index = parseInt(Math.random() * 0xFFFFFF, 10) | |
module.exports = ObjectID |
